## Customer Concentration — Haldren Account (Managers Only)

Haldren Group now represents 41% of Ostreva's recurring revenue, up from 28% last year. Sales leads should treat renewal risk here as critical: any pricing dispute could materially affect forecasts. Diversification targets are being set per territory. The mitigation plan we intend to pursue is outlined below.

board note of yawep-fahif: Gross margin on Wenath came in at 15 percent against a plan of 5 percent. Only 9 of the 140 pilot accounts renewed Wenath, so a churn review is set for April 15.

The renewal of our three-year agreement with Torvane Materials has been assessed in detail. Proposed terms include a 4.2% unit-price increase, partially offset by improved volume rebates and extended payment terms of sixty days. Sensitivity analysis indicates a net annual cost impact of under 1% on the Meridia product line, assuming stable demand. Legal has flagged no material changes to liability clauses. We recommend approval, subject to the conditions outlined in the confidential note below.

confidential, yawip-bahif: Zorokox Partners plans to lower the Casax list price by 28.0 percent in April. The board signed off on a budget of $271.0 million for Project Juldor. The renewal with Pelokox Partners closes at $410.1 million a year, 3.4 percent below the last contract. Project Pelok slips by a full year because of the audit delay.

**Ticket PARITY-412: Kestrel SDK catch-up**

Quick one for the weekly sync: the Kestrel-Go SDK is still missing batched uploads and retry hints that Kestrel-JS shipped two releases ago. Partner teams keep asking. Plan is to land both behind a flag this sprint and cut a minor release. Needs a sign-off from the owner named below.

account owner for bajef-badup: Drueth Kelath Pelael Holwyn

Quick primer for the weekly sync. Tidewatch is the little tide-table widget embedded on the Gullsmere harbor portal. We keep three environments: dev (fake tide data, refreshes constantly), staging (real gauge feeds from the Pelton Sound simulator, caches for five minutes), and prod (live feeds, aggressive caching, don't poke it on weekends). Most confusion comes from staging's simulator lagging real tides by a few hours — that's expected, not a bug. For reference during the sync, staging currently runs with the following values.

service settings:
PRAIX_LOG_LEVEL=error
PRAIX_METRICS_HOST=metrics.praix.qorvelcorp.corp
PRAIX_POOL_SIZE=16